Rediscovering the Shiny and New

We are all drawn to the shiny and the new. Brightly colored gifts arranged beautifully under a tree can catch anyone’s eye and cause a smile. Shiny paper and big bows bring about excitement, anticipation, and desire. We treasure these gifts but what happens days, weeks, months, and eventually years later? What happens when the new becomes dusty, old, and forgotten?


As I packed for my trip home to the States for Christmas, I spent time going through my closet. In doing so, I was surprised to find a small number of clothes hidden in the corners of my closet that I had completely forgotten about. Clothes that I had once adored but forgotten about, were now new to me again. In forgetting about them, their rediscovery brought about new life. I tried the clothing on if for the first time and it brought a smile to my face. One jacket in particular brought about memories from a happy time in life. I smile and wondered . . . what in my life have I forgotten to treasure because it has become hidden, overlooked, and dusty? What was once treasured because it was new and exciting but now has become boring and old?


Perhaps it is your husband. Remember when you first fell in love? The butterflies in your stomach? What can you do to remember and rebuild the flame? Or perhaps it is your job that now bores you? Remember the excitement of interviewing and being offered the position? Or perhaps it is your home? Remember the excitement of buying or renting it for the first time? There are many things that we are so used to now that we fail to treasure them anymore.


As we begin a new year, try to find the beauty in what you already have. Learn to see everything as it is shiny and new once again.
